General Information About Porcelain Veneers
Porcelain veneers are used as a way to cover teeth helping to resolve discoloration and problems with chipped teeth. Porcelain veneers are made from a thin veneer that is translucent in color. The veneers can be placed on any tooth necessary. Porcelain veneers are a permanent cosmetic dental treatment. Once in place the veneers will last a long time.
Those with thinning enamel or dingy colored teeth may be good candidates for porcelain veneers. The dentist takes careful measurements and impressions of the teeth. This information is sent to a dental lab where the veneers will be created. Once ready the dentist will adhere the dental veneers to the teeth.
The dentist will likely need to file the teeth slightly in order to fit the porcelain veneers in place. The veneers can cover many small problems with the teeth. These problems are primarily cosmetic in nature such as slight gaps between teeth and small chips or cracks. The dental veneers cover these problems and help to create a beautiful looking smile.
Porcelain veneers are often part of a smile makeover. A smile makeover is often done to help make a more beautiful smile. Porcelain veneers are typically considered a cosmetic treatment and may not be covered by insurance. Porcelain veneers are usually done by a cosmetic dentist that specializes in cosmetic dentistry. The first step towards getting cosmetic dentistry is a consultation. The dentist will examine the patient's teeth and will help come up with a recommendation that is right for him or her. Porcelain veneers may require two or more dental visits. The first visit will be used to take impressions. Once the veneers are ready to place another appointment is necessary. The dentist may file down the teeth as needed and will then apply the veneers using permanent bond. Another visit may be necessary depending on the number of porcelain veneers you will be getting.
